Four Featured Artists Transform Dibond Into Unique Works Of Fine Art

Although traditionally an exterior signage material, Dibond continues to be integrated into the world of fine art. Its rigidity and smooth surface enables the material to be painted, mounted and cut with ease allowing a variety of artists around the world to utilize it. Each of the featured artists transforms the material, showcasing both versatility and innovation.

Renowned London Based Cityscape Painter Experiments With Dibond Aluminum Composite

Christopher Farrell is a renowned fine artist based in London. His illustrious career began after studying Visual Arts at De Montfort University and then gaining his post-graduate degree at the RA Schools. It was at the RA Schools that he received a variety of awards and an invitation to Buckingham Palace to meet the Queen to acknowledge the achievements of young people in the UK.

Hand-Painted Murals Stretch Across Acclaimed Illinois Highway Using Dibond Aluminum Composite Substrate

As a centennial celebration, the Lincoln Highway’s history was immortalized with a series of hand-painted murals that stretch across 179 miles of Illinois from Fulton to Lynwood. Once the original U.S. 30 route, the historical significance of the Lincoln Highway was captured with a series, hand-painted by Jay Allen.
